Side by side GE , a couple of weeks ago I came home it was frozed up , I let all the ice melt and changed the coil and thermostat and everything was all good , then it iced up again ...

I checked and changed the timer and it's been running fine until today ..

I checked and it's iced up again, I put it in defrost cycle and both coils are heating up , the timer seems to be working.... any advise
